About Xingen Lu

Xingen Lu is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Computational Mechanics, Mechanical Engineering, Fluid Flow and Transfer Processes and Mechanics of Materials, having authored 56 papers that have together received 336 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Turbomachinery Performance and Optimization (48 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Turbulent Flows (30 papers), Heat Transfer Mechanisms (17 papers), Aerodynamics and Fluid Dynamics Research (15 papers),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Technologies (12 papers), Combustion and flame dynamics (6 papers), Aerodynamics and Acoustics in Jet Flows (5 papers) and Computational Fluid Dynamics and Aerodynamics (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Aerospace Engineering (270 citations), Computational Mechanics (180 citations), Mechanical Engineering (217 citations), Fluid Flow and Transfer Processes (15 citations) and Statistical and Nonlinear Physics (10 citations). Xingen Lu has collaborated with scholars based in China, India and Ireland. Frequent co-authors include Junqiang Zhu, Ge Han, Shengfeng Zhao, Yanfeng Zhang, Chengwu Yang, Hongzhi Cheng, Wuli Chu, Jinliang Xu, Guoqing Li and Ziliang Li. Their work appears in journals such as Applied Thermal Engineering, Aerospace Science and Technology, Proceedings of the Institution of Mechanical Engineers Part A Journal of Power and Energy, International Journal of Heat and Fluid Flow and Proceedings of the Institution of Mechanical Engineers Part C Journal of Mechanical Engineering Science.
